Charles Grannum

A proud native of Clinton Hill in Brooklyn, NY, Dr. Charles Grannum received his Bachelor's Degree in Biology from the University of Pennsylvania, and Doctorate of Dental Medicine from Fairleigh Dickenson University School of Dentistry. Dr. Grannum was certified in the specialty of Prosthodontics from Columbia University School of Dental and Oral Surgery, and completed residency training programs at both Woodhull and Harlem Hospitals.

Dr. Grannum has been honored for excellence in his field by esteemed institutions like Columbia University, Harlem Hospital and Bronx Lebanon Hospital. With a passion for learning and teaching, Dr. Grannum is the Director of Prosthodontics and faculty member at both Interfaith and Harlem Hospitals, were he teaches the specialty of Prosthodontics to dental residents. Dr. Grannum has sustained his quality, professional care with a successful private practice in Clinton Hill for over 20 years.

Dr. Grannum lives by the modest, yet profound act of giving. He is a leader in his community, (having served as Board Member and Secretary of the Pratt Area Community Council (PACC), a member of the Protestant Board of Guardians, a non-profit social services agency that keeps families together through preventive services and counseling. His dedication and contributions have been recognized by Emmanuel Baptist Church, Bridge Street AWME Church, and numerous other organizations.
